This appeal is from a judgment of the superior court denying Carlos Ayala's petition for writ of prohibition.

The petition sought to prohibit the Ventura County Municipal Court, and particularly Judge Frederick Jones, from taking further action on Ayala's case.

The petition alleged as follows:
